Joseph Bozkaya | Designing for Scalability from the Start
Designing for scalability from the beginning is crucial for building a product that can grow seamlessly. Implementing scalable architecture involves choosing flexible technologies and designing systems that can handle increased loads without significant redesigns. For instance, leveraging microservices architecture can provide modularity and ease of scaling individual components as needed.
Incorporate scalable data management practices by utilizing distributed databases or cloud-based solutions that can grow with the product as suggested by leaders such as Joseph Bozkaya. This foresight ensures that the product’s infrastructure can adapt to changing demands and supports smooth scaling operations. Early design considerations can prevent costly and complex changes later in the development process.
Comments
Post a Comment